Florence’s 15th annual River to River Florence Indian Film Festival is turning to the public for help in meeting the costs of important ‘extras,’ like bringing a special guest from India.

The festival, which this year runs from December 5 to 10 at Cinema Odeon, features documentaries, Bollywood films, short films and video art.

The crowdfunding campaign, which started on September 7 on Indiegogo, seeks to raise 15,000 euro by November 5. To contribute, go to igg.me/at/R2RFIFF2015.

 

In addition, the festival is holding two fundraising events: on September 24, enjoy an Indian-themed aperitivo with lounge music at Serre Torrigiani in via dei Serragli; or dance the night away Bollywood style (details TBA). For the festival programme, see www.rivertoriver.it/en.
